Greatest Hits

Greatest Hits (1998) more music like this

by Earth, Wind & Fire

Columbia's 1998 collection of Earth, Wind & Fire's Greatest Hits in many ways stands as the group's definitive compilation. Even though there have been more extensive overviews of the group's work, such as the triple-disc set The Eternal Dance, this is the first collection to contain all of the group's biggest hits on one disc. That's the Way of the World

That's the Way of the World (1975) more music like this

by Earth, Wind & Fire

Earth, Wind & Fire has delivered more than its share of excellent albums, but if a person could own only one EWF release, the logical choice would be That's the Way of the World, which was the band's best album as well as its best-selling. Greatest Hits Live (1996) more music like this

by Earth, Wind & Fire

Greatest Hits Live captures Earth, Wind & Fire in concert in Tokyo during 1995, running through a number of the group's best-known songs and biggest hits. It's a fun performance for dedicated fans. Leo Stanley, All Music Guide

The Collection: That's the Way of the World/All 'N All/Gratitude [2005 Reissue] (2005) more music like this

by Earth, Wind & Fire

The Collection is a three-disc package that houses Earth, Wind & Fire's That's the Way of the World (1975), Gratitude (1975), and All 'n All (1977). These are the reissue versions released in 1999 by Columbia/Legacy, so they feature remastered sound, bonus tracks, and useful liner notes.
